On , OSHA opened a planned safety inspection of MAC EXTERIORS LLC in 8001 W. BELMONT AVE., RIVER GROVE, IL 60171 (NAICS 238160). OSHA activity number 339237745.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(1): Each employee on a walking/working surface with an unprotected side or edge which was 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above a lower level was not protected from falling by the use of guardrail systems, safety net systems, or personal fall arrest systems: a) Employees were exposed to the hazard of falling approximately 24 feet while disposing of roofing materials and debris at the roof edge where fall protection had not been provided. 29 CFR 1926.501(b)(10): Each employee engaged in roofing activities on low-slope roofs with unprotected sides and edges 6 feet or more above lower levels, was not protected from falling by guardrail systems, safety net systems, personal fall arrest systems, or a combination of warning line system and guardrail system, warning line system and safety net system, or warning line system and personal fall arrest system, or warning line system and safety monitoring system. Or, on roofs 50-feet (15.25 m) or less in width, each employee was not protected by use of a monitoring system: a) Employees were exposed to the hazard of falling approximately 24 feet from the edge of the roof deck while engaged in roofing activities without the use of fall protection or a safety monitoring system. 29 CFR 1926.501(b)(4)(i): Each employee on walking/working surfaces was not protected from falling through holes (including skylights) more than 6 feet (1.8 m) above lower levels by personal fall arrest systems, covers or guardrail systems erected around such holes: a) Employees were exposed to the hazard of falling approximately 11 feet through unprotected skylights located in the roof deck work area. 29 CFR 1926.502(f)(4): Mechanical equipment on roofs was used or stored in areas where employees were not protected by a warning line system, guardrail system, or personal fall arrest system: a) Employees were exposed to the hazard of falling approximately 24 feet where mechanical equipment was used to cut the roof deck without the benefit of fall protection. 29 CFR 1926.502(j)(7)(i): Material and equipment were stored within 6 feet (1.8m) of a roof edge: a) Lumber and scrap metal materials were stored along the edge of the roof deck exposing employees to the hazard of falling approximately 24 feet.
